Quotes from John Lennon
Posted by pauliesplatform on January 26, 2008
“Nobody told me there’d be days like these” – from the song Nobody Told Me
“Life is what happens to you while you’re busy making other plans” -from Beautiful Boy (Darling Boy)
“Christ, you know it ain’t easy” -from The Ballad of John and Yoko
These are my three favorite quotes about the human condition. I am not much of a fan of poetry because I usually just don’t get them. But John Lennon was most definitely a poet. He put his poetry into his music and that’s why his words make more sense to me. I have been interested in his life and music since I became an adult and it is the above three quotes that I site when people ask who my favorite poet is or what my favorite quotes are. For anyone who is interested in the life of Lennon after the Beatles I recommend watching the movie “U.S. vs. John Lennon” which is now on DVD. It chronicles the story of how the Nixon administration wanted to deport Lennon because they were afraid of his political power and views during the Vietnam era. It really shows what made Lennon tick and where his musical talent came from.
